Fast Autofocus Sensor Technology
Fastest Autofocus Sensor Cameras for Run-and-Gun Shoots – Advancements in autofocus sensor technology have revolutionized the way photographers and videographers capture fast-moving subjects. Recent years have seen significant improvements, thanks to innovations that enhance speed, accuracy, and reliability in various shooting conditions.The two primary types of autofocus systems are phase detection and contrast detection. Phase detection autofocus works by evaluating the light coming through the lens and splitting it into two images; this allows the camera to determine the distance to the subject quickly.
Contrast detection, on the other hand, analyzes the contrast of the images captured by the camera’s sensor and focuses on achieving the highest contrast, making it generally slower but more precise in controlled environments. Machine learning plays a crucial role in improving autofocus performance. By analyzing vast amounts of data from previous shots, cameras equipped with AI can learn to predict where subjects will move, adjusting focus parameters in real-time.
This technology vastly enhances the ability to track subjects, particularly in dynamic settings.
Key Features of Autofocus Systems in Cameras
When searching for cameras designed for fast autofocus capabilities, several essential features should be prioritized to ensure optimal performance during shoots. Understanding these characteristics can make a significant difference in capturing the perfect moment.
- Autofocus Points: The number and distribution of autofocus points directly influence a camera’s ability to lock onto subjects quickly. A higher number of focus points typically leads to better tracking abilities.
- Coverage Area: Cameras with wide coverage areas allow for more flexibility in composition and better tracking of moving subjects across the frame.
- Face and Eye Detection: These advanced features enhance autofocus accuracy by prioritizing the subject’s face or eyes, ensuring that the most critical elements are always in sharp focus.
Best Cameras for Run-and-Gun Shoots: Fastest Autofocus Sensor Cameras For Run-and-Gun Shoots
In the fast-paced world of run-and-gun shooting, having the right camera can make all the difference. The following cameras stand out for their autofocus capabilities, low-light performance, and video quality, making them ideal for dynamic environments.
- Canon EOS R6: Known for its superb Dual Pixel autofocus system, the EOS R6 provides exceptional low-light performance and a high frame rate for video shooting.
- Sony A7S III: This camera excels in low-light conditions and features a fast hybrid autofocus system, making it a favorite among videographers.
- Fujifilm X-T4: With its impressive continuous autofocus and in-body stabilization, the X-T4 is perfect for capturing smooth footage on the go.
Techniques for Optimizing Autofocus during Shoots, Fastest Autofocus Sensor Cameras for Run-and-Gun Shoots
To maximize the effectiveness of autofocus systems in dynamic shooting environments, various techniques can be implemented. These strategies allow for seamless transitions and precise focus on moving subjects.
- Autofocus Settings: Fine-tuning your autofocus settings for different scenarios—such as using continuous autofocus mode for moving subjects—ensures that the camera adapts to the environment.
- Tracking Moving Subjects: Utilize the camera’s subject tracking capabilities, adjusting the autofocus area to keep the subject in focus as they move across the frame.
- Manual Focus Assist: In critical moments, switching to manual focus assist can provide the precision needed for capturing fast-paced actions accurately.
